Oprah. Ellen. Regis & Kelly. John & Rebekah.

John & Rebekah? Yep, they are the new hosts of “Twin Cities Live,” the KSTP afternoon talker that debuts Monday. We take a behind-the-scenes look at the daily program in Sunday’s paper (feel free to share your thoughts here).

I’ll say upfront that I’m rooting for ‘em. The market has long deserved an afternoon talk show with a local bent and “TCL” seems to be focusing on the right things: Cheap outings, local music, family-friendly tips, exercise, local restaurants. But is there enough content to fill an hour every weekday? More importantly, is there enough local guests?

Being a good host is tough - but so is being a good guest. One reason you see the same “experts” show up on so many shows is that there is a dearth of good people who can be witty, insightful and quick on their feet in a five-minute segment. How many people within driving distance of the KSTP studios fit that bill?
